Why Replace Bifold Door Glass?
There are numerous reasons that you may require to replace the glass panels in your bifold doors. A few of the most typical reasons include:
- Cracks or breaks: Glass panels can crack or break due to various reasons such as accidents, extreme climate condition, or wear and tear.
- Seal failure: Over time, the seal in between the glass panels and the door frame can fail, resulting in air leakages, wetness invasion, and energy inadequacy.
- Condensation: If the glass panels are not properly sealed or if the door is not set up correctly, condensation can form in between the glass panels, leading to mold and mildew growth.
- Aesthetic reasons: You may want to replace the glass panels to update the look of your bifold doors or to match a brand-new interior design.

Kinds of Glass for Bifold Doors
When it comes to changing glass panels in bifold doors, there are several kinds of glass to select from, including:
- Single glazing: This kind of glass consists of a single pane of glass and is generally used in older bifold doors.
- Double glazing: This kind of glass consists of two panes of glass separated by a space, which supplies improved energy performance and noise decrease.
- Triple glazing: This type of glass consists of three panes of glass separated by gaps, which provides even higher energy efficiency and noise reduction.
- Low-e glass: This type of glass has an unique finish that lowers heat transfer, making it an energy-efficient choice.
- Tinted glass: This type of glass has a tinted finishing that can minimize glare and supply UV protection.
How to Replace Bifold Door Glass
Changing glass panels in bifold doors can be a DIY task, however it requires some skill and perseverance. Here is a step-by-step guide on how to do it:
- Prepare the area: Before starting the job, make sure the area around the bifold doors is clear of furniture and other blockages.
- Remove the door: Take the bifold door out of its track and lay it on a flat surface area.
- Get rid of the old glass: Carefully remove the old glass panel from the door frame, making sure not to harm the surrounding material.
- Tidy the frame: Clean the door frame and surrounding area to ensure a smooth installation process.
- Install the new glass: Place the brand-new glass panel into the door frame, ensuring it is correctly lined up and secured.
- Replace the door: Put the bifold door back in its track and ensure it is appropriately lined up and protected.
Frequently Asked Questions
Q: How much does it cost to replace bifold door glass?A: The expense of replacing bifold door glass depends on the type and size of the glass, as well as the complexity of the installation. On average, the cost can range from ₤ 500 to ₤ 2,000.
Q: Can I replace bifold door glass myself?A: Yes, changing bifold door glass can be a DIY project, but it needs some skill and persistence. If you are not comfortable with the installation process, it is advised to hire an expert.
Q: What type of glass is best for bifold doors?A: The kind of glass best for bifold doors depends on your particular needs and preferences. Double glazing and low-e glass are popular alternatives for their energy performance and sound reduction properties.
